Data Matching Software Features
- Pattern Matching: Pattern matching technology is used to find similar patterns between two different sets of data. This can be used to detect fraudulent activities or inaccurate information in databases.
- Data Reduction: Data reduction allows users to reduce the number of data points present in a database by eliminating duplicate, outdated, and irrelevant entries while maintaining the accuracy and completeness of the remaining dataset.
- Linkage Analysis: Linkage analysis is a process that involves cross-referencing and analyzing records from multiple sources simultaneously in order to identify relationships, trends, similarities, or discrepancies among them. This can help organizations detect fraud more quickly and accurately than other methods of screening for inaccuracies.
- Duplicate Record Detection: Duplicate record detection uses pattern matching or fuzzy logic algorithms to spot duplicate records within a database which could otherwise cause errors or inaccuracies if left unchecked.
- Standardization/Normalization: Standardization and normalization are both processes used by data matching software that reformat data into consistent formats so that it may be easily compared against other datasets without introducing differences due to formatting inconsistencies between them (e.g., date formats).
- Validation & Verification: Validation and verification are crucial components in any data matching system as they ensure accurate results by comparing inputted information against existing records for accuracy before it is entered into the main database for further use or comparison with other datasets.

Data Matching Software Risks
- Accuracy: Data matching software can be vulnerable to errors in its results due to the complexity of the data sets being analyzed and compared. Additionally, mistakes can occur during the input process (i.e. incorrect or incomplete data).
- Accessibility: If unauthorized people have access to the software or are able to view its results, it could lead to a breach of confidentiality or misuse of sensitive personal data.
- Security: Malicious users could use data matching software in order to commit fraud or identity theft if they gain access to secure networks and systems where such information is stored.
- Privacy: Poorly-designed data matching software may not protect individuals’ privacy rights, as it might collect more information than necessary and/or share that information with third parties without explicit consent from the individual concerned.
- Reliability: There is always a risk that the software may become outdated over time as technology advances (e.g., new algorithms for detecting patterns) and therefore should be regularly monitored for updates and improvements in order remain reliable.

What Are Some Questions To Ask When Considering Data Matching Software?
- What kind of data formats does the software support?
- Does the software offer any de-duplication capabilities to identify matching records?
- Is there an option for fuzzy logic algorithms to match similar but not exact records?
- How user friendly is the interface for creating and running rules to match records?
- Are there different types of matching algorithms available (e.g., name, address, etc.)?
- Can you batch-process large datasets in a single pass or will it require multiple passes to complete the job?
- Does the software run on a centralized server platform or can it be distributed across multiple systems?
- What kind of security measures are in place to protect sensitive data during matching operations?
- Does the software provide data storage solutions so users don't have to manually store results outside of the application itself?
- What sort of scalability options are available for larger datasets and more complex needs?
